Annotation | In 1994, the Department of Social Security (DSS) commissioned Social and Community Planning Research (SCPR) to undertake a programme of research examining women's pension provision and the factors that influence women's pension decisions. This summary outlines SCPR's findings, including factors concerning the potential for building up pension rights, and income expectations in retirement. It also looks at findings on divorce and the treatment of pension rights. The full reports of this Department of Social Security research - "Women and pensions" (DSS Research report no.49), and "Pensions and divorce" (DSS Research report no.50) - are published by HMSO.
